
After OM's victory against Aston Villa, the Marseille coach insisted on the importance of all his attackers for the coming season, to cope with a busy calendar.
Olympique de Marseille concluded its pre-season on a good note by winning a great success against Aston Villa (3-1), Saturday at the Vélodrome. Double scorer against the Villans, Pierre-Emerick Aubameyang immediately revives the debate on the holder at the new number position for the coming season.
With the presence of the Gabonese, but also those of Amine Gouiri, one of Roberto de Zerbi's privileged options, as well as Neal Maupay, the Marseille coach has a complete offensive arsenal to approach the 2024-25 exercise. Asked about this subject, the Italian was limpid as to the competition which promises to be between his attackers.
“We will need everyone”
“They may be able to play together, but in my head there is little hierarchy. We are going to play 43 or 44 games at least this season, maybe even more if we advance in the French Cup and the Champions League, so we will need everyone. I cannot give percentages, but it is certain that Rabiot, Højbjerg, Balerd, Greenwood will probably play more than others. I therefore do not ask myself the question of the hierarchy ”explained RDZ.
OM will actually have to count on all its men to take the distance this season. After a year without European Cup, the vice-champion of France finds the Champions League, in an unprecedented format launched in 2024-25, promising a demanding calendar and calling for maximum involvement of the entire Marseille workforce.
